The evaluation of diminished incomes capability ensuing from harm or wrongful termination typically necessitates a projection of earnings a claimant would have possible earned had the incident not occurred. This calculation generally incorporates components comparable to age, training, occupation, and anticipated profession trajectory, adjusted for variables like inflation and potential promotions. These projections present a quantitative foundation for figuring out the financial affect of the earnings loss.
Precisely quantifying misplaced earnings is essential for honest compensation in authorized proceedings. It supplies an goal measure of the monetary hurt suffered, enabling equitable settlements and judgments. Traditionally, such projections relied on guide calculations and subjective estimations. The appearance of subtle actuarial science and econometric modeling has allowed for larger precision and objectivity in these assessments, minimizing potential biases and enhancing the reliability of the ultimate determine. This refined strategy bolsters the credibility of economic claims and assists in resolving disputes extra effectively.

1. Base Earnings
Base earnings symbolize the foundational factor in calculating misplaced future wages. They function the place to begin for projecting the earnings stream a person would have possible earned had an harm or wrongful termination not occurred. The accuracy of this preliminary determine is paramount, as any inaccuracies will probably be compounded all through the projection course of. For example, if an people established earnings, together with wage and advantages, are underestimated, the ensuing projection of future misplaced wages will inherently be poor. Conversely, an inflated base earnings determine will result in an overestimation of financial damages.
The dedication of base earnings sometimes entails a evaluate of historic earnings data, together with pay stubs, tax returns, and employment contracts. It’s important to contemplate all sources of earnings, comparable to bonuses, commissions, and fringe advantages, to reach at a complete determine. In circumstances involving self-employed people, enterprise data and monetary statements are scrutinized to ascertain a dependable earnings historical past. For instance, take into account a development employee injured on the job. Their base earnings would incorporate hourly wages, extra time pay, and any union advantages. A transparent and substantiated calculation of those base earnings is non-negotiable for estimating misplaced future earnings.
In conclusion, establishing an correct base earnings determine is the bedrock upon which projections of future misplaced earnings are constructed. Challenges can come up when earnings are irregular or undocumented, necessitating cautious evaluation and doubtlessly using professional testimony. A correct understanding of the vital position base earnings performs ensures equity and accuracy in authorized settlements and judgments relating to diminished incomes capability. Any deficiency in figuring out base earnings will invalidate all the calculation.
2. Development Price
The projection of misplaced future earnings requires accounting for potential will increase in earnings over time, an element represented by the expansion fee. This fee displays the anticipated share change in earnings attributable to promotions, expertise, or basic financial developments throughout the claimant’s occupation. A better development fee leads to a bigger projected earnings stream, consequently growing the calculated loss. For example, an accountant on a companion observe would possible expertise a steeper development fee than one remaining at a employees accountant degree, considerably impacting projected earnings.
Deciding on an acceptable development fee is a vital step, typically involving reliance on historic earnings information for the person, {industry} averages, or macroeconomic forecasts. Labor statistics revealed by authorities companies, such because the Bureau of Labor Statistics, present useful information for estimating occupational development charges. These information typically differentiate development by {industry} sector and expertise degree. Ignoring this issue, or using an inaccurate development fee, can result in a considerable misrepresentation of the claimant’s true financial damages. For example, failing to account for the everyday profession development development in a particular subject would understate the loss.
Due to this fact, the expansion fee acts as a multiplier within the projection mannequin. Challenges in figuring out an acceptable fee come up when historic information is proscribed or when the claimant was on the cusp of a big profession transition. Professional testimony from economists or vocational consultants typically turns into essential to justify the chosen development fee and make sure the projection aligns with practical profession trajectories. A radical and well-supported development fee is important for an correct and defensible calculation of misplaced future earnings.
3. Work-Life Expectancy
Work-life expectancy constitutes a vital variable in projecting misplaced future earnings. It represents the estimated variety of years a person is predicted to stay actively employed. Its inclusion in a projection immediately impacts the period over which misplaced earnings are calculated; an extended work-life expectancy leads to a better complete projected loss. For instance, a person of their early thirties who sustains a disabling harm would sometimes have a considerably longer work-life expectancy than somebody approaching retirement, thus the calculated financial loss is projected to be considerably bigger.
The dedication of work-life expectancy entails statistical evaluation of demographic information, contemplating components comparable to age, gender, occupation, and academic attainment. Actuarial tables and authorities publications, comparable to these supplied by the Bureau of Labor Statistics, present useful information for estimating the typical remaining years within the labor drive for numerous demographic teams. Sure occupations, significantly these involving bodily demanding labor, could have a shorter common work-life expectancy. For example, a development employee could have a decrease work-life expectancy in comparison with a pc programmer of the identical age. Correct evaluation of work-life expectancy is essential to keep away from overstating or understating the precise financial loss suffered by the claimant.
In conclusion, work-life expectancy is an important element in calculating misplaced future wages, immediately influencing the magnitude of the projected loss. Challenges come up when the claimant’s profession path is unsure or when pre-existing situations could affect their capacity to stay employed. Due to this fact, an intensive and well-supported evaluation of work-life expectancy, using dependable information sources and professional evaluation, is important for correct and defensible projections of future misplaced earnings. Failing to precisely set up work-life expectancy would render the calculation invalid.
4. Low cost Price
The low cost fee serves as a vital element within the calculation of misplaced future earnings. It acknowledges that cash obtained at the moment is price greater than the identical quantity obtained sooner or later, a precept referred to as the time worth of cash. Due to this fact, future earnings should be discounted to their current worth to replicate this distinction. The number of an acceptable low cost fee considerably impacts the general calculation.
-
Definition and Function
The low cost fee represents the speed of return that might be earned on an funding over the interval throughout which the misplaced wages would have been obtained. Its major objective is to transform the stream of future misplaced earnings right into a lump-sum current worth, which represents the financial damages suffered. This current worth represents the sum of money required at the moment to switch the misplaced future earnings stream.
-
Components Influencing the Price
A number of components affect the number of a reduction fee. These embrace prevailing rates of interest, inflation expectations, and the perceived danger related to the projected earnings stream. Greater rates of interest and inflation expectations sometimes result in larger low cost charges. Equally, a extra unstable or unsure earnings stream could warrant a better low cost fee to replicate the elevated danger.
-
Influence on the Calculation
The low cost fee has an inverse relationship with the current worth of misplaced future earnings. A better low cost fee leads to a decrease current worth, whereas a decrease low cost fee results in a better current worth. It is because a better low cost fee implies a larger alternative value of receiving the cash sooner or later, thus decreasing its current worth.
-
Authorized and Financial Issues
The number of a reduction fee is usually topic to authorized scrutiny and financial evaluation. Courts could present steering on acceptable ranges for low cost charges, and professional testimony from economists is often used to justify the chosen fee. The objective is to pick a reduction fee that precisely displays the financial realities of the state of affairs and ensures a good and cheap calculation of misplaced future earnings.
The applying of the low cost fee is important for changing projected future earnings right into a tangible present-day worth. Failure to precisely apply this precept within the context of calculating misplaced future wages would create an inaccurate outcome. The ultimate determine should replicate the diminished financial potential because of the earnings loss.
5. Current Worth
The idea of current worth kinds an integral element inside any calculation of misplaced future earnings. These earnings, projected to accrue over a claimant’s remaining work-life expectancy, should be adjusted to replicate their worth in present {dollars}. This adjustment acknowledges the time worth of cash, which posits {that a} greenback obtained at the moment is price greater than a greenback obtained sooner or later attributable to its potential incomes capability. The applying of current worth rules converts the stream of projected future earnings right into a single, lump-sum determine representing the claimant’s financial loss on the time of settlement or judgment. Failure to account for current worth would lead to an inflated and economically unsound estimate of damages. A easy instance illustrates this level: if a projection signifies a lack of $50,000 per 12 months for ten years, the entire nominal loss is $500,000. Nonetheless, the current worth of this earnings stream, discounted at an affordable fee, will probably be considerably decrease than $500,000, reflecting the chance value of receiving these funds sooner or later reasonably than at the moment.
The low cost fee utilized in current worth calculations is a vital determinant of the ultimate injury determine. This fee represents the speed of return that might be fairly anticipated on an funding made at the moment. A better low cost fee reduces the current worth of future earnings, whereas a decrease fee will increase it. Choice of an acceptable low cost fee typically entails financial evaluation and professional testimony, contemplating components comparable to prevailing rates of interest, inflation expectations, and the danger related to the projected earnings stream. In apply, a claimant’s professional will typically argue for a decrease low cost fee to maximise the calculated current worth, whereas the opposing social gathering could advocate for a better fee to attenuate it. The last word dedication of the low cost fee rests with the court docket or the negotiating events, knowledgeable by financial rules and authorized precedent.
In abstract, current worth evaluation supplies the mechanism for translating a projection of future misplaced earnings right into a present, economically sound measure of damages. Its software is important for guaranteeing equity and accuracy in settlements and judgments associated to diminished incomes capability. The number of an acceptable low cost fee stays a central level of rivalry in these calculations, requiring cautious consideration of financial components and authorized rules. A correct understanding of the current worth idea is essential for authorized professionals, economists, and anybody concerned in assessing the financial affect of misplaced future earnings.

7. Mitigation Efforts
Mitigation efforts immediately affect the calculation of future misplaced wages. Actions taken by an injured social gathering or wrongfully terminated worker to attenuate financial damages are thought-about when figuring out the extent of economic compensation. The premise underlying this consideration is that claimants have a duty to actively search various employment or retraining alternatives to scale back the long-term monetary affect of their loss. Due to this fact, a failure to make cheap mitigation efforts can lead to a discount within the quantity of future misplaced wages awarded. For instance, if a person with transferable abilities refuses to pursue available employment alternatives in a associated subject, the court docket could scale back the projected misplaced earnings to replicate the earnings that might have been earned via diligent mitigation.
Documentation of mitigation efforts is essential for each plaintiffs and defendants in authorized proceedings involving misplaced wages. Plaintiffs should reveal energetic steps taken to safe employment, together with job purposes, interviews, and enrollment in retraining packages. Defendants, conversely, could current proof exhibiting an absence of cheap mitigation or the supply of appropriate employment alternatives that the claimant declined. The absence of documented efforts might be interpreted as a failure to fulfill the authorized obligation to attenuate damages. Contemplate a state of affairs the place a talented carpenter sustains an harm stopping them from performing heavy labor. If the carpenter doesn’t pursue lighter carpentry work, retraining for a associated subject comparable to drafting, or different cheap various employment, the projected misplaced wages could also be adjusted downward based mostly on this lack of mitigation. An acceptable exploration of incomes capability must happen.
In the end, the idea of mitigation efforts serves as a test in opposition to unwarranted or inflated claims for future misplaced wages. It incentivizes claimants to actively take part in their very own financial restoration, whereas additionally guaranteeing equity and reasonableness within the dedication of damages. Courts and authorized professionals fastidiously scrutinize the proof introduced relating to mitigation, balancing the claimant’s obligation to attenuate losses with the realities of the job market and the person’s particular circumstances. An entire understanding of each duties ensures the integrity of the longer term misplaced wages calculation.
